比特币是一种去中心化的数字货币,能够让用户在没有中介的情况下进行交易。在全球范围内,比特币的普及速度逐年上涨,而如何安全地存储和管理比特币成为了许多用户非常关心的问题。其中,比特币钱包地址的位数是一个非常重要的方面,关系到交易的安全性和钱包的易用性。本文将详细探讨比特币钱包地址的位数、其重要性、以及其他相关问题。
比特币钱包地址的构成与位数
比特币的钱包地址是由一串字母和数字组成的唯一标识符,用于标识一个比特币账号。通常,比特币地址有几种格式,包括传统的P2PKH(以1开头)和P2SH(以3开头)地址,以及新兴的Bech32地址(以bc1开头)。这些地址的位数有所不同:
1. **P2PKH地址**:传统的比特币地址,通常是34位数,并且是以数字“1”开头。它包含字母与数字的组合,例如“1A1zP1eP5QGefi2DMPTfTL5SLmv7DivfNa”。
2. **P2SH地址**:类似于P2PKH地址,通常是34位数,以数字“3”开头。例如,“3J98t1Wi5XAvVWX2uegU4sbZzY8Xz6sBiG”。
3. **Bech32地址**:最新推出的格式,以“bc1”开头,长度变化较大,但通常在42位左右。这种格式主要是在隔离见证(SegWit)升级中引入的,目的是提高比特币的效率,例如“bc1qw508d6qejxtdg4y5r3zq8u1h3z6mte7lvh9c2g”。
从数字上来看,尽管比特币地址的长度有所变化,但根本原理是确保每个地址都是唯一的,以保障交易的安全性。
为什么比特币钱包地址的位数重要?
比特币钱包地址的位数直接关系到安全性和用户体验。以下几点能够阐释其中的原因:
1. **唯一性**:每个比特币地址都是唯一的,位数的增加能够有效的减少地址重复生成的可能性。想象一下,如果所有地址都是固定的短小格式,那么碰撞(多个用户拥有相同地址)的风险将大大提高。
2. **防止错误**:较长的地址虽然在输入时可能容易出错,但相对较长的字符组合降低了重复或错误输入的风险,尤其是在有大量类似字符的情况下。现代钱包软件通常提供了二维码功能,进一步降低了手动输入时的风险。
3. **安全防护**:比特币钱包地址不直接暴露用户的身份,相对来说具有一定的匿名性。长地址的使用在一定程度上能够保护用户的隐私,特别是在多方交易时,避免被追踪。
如何生成安全的比特币钱包地址?
生成比特币钱包地址的过程依赖于强大的密码学算法。以下是生成安全钱包地址的基础步骤:
1. **选择合适的钱包软件**:市面上有许多电子钱包可以选择,用户应选择信誉良好的钱包软件。钱包软件提供生成地址和存储私钥的功能,应优先选择安全性较高且具有良好用户评价的产品。
2. **私钥生成**:安全的比特币钱包通常使用随机数生成器(RNG)来生成私钥。私钥是用户访问其比特币的唯一凭证,绝对不能泄露给他人。确保生成私钥时使用高质量的随机数生成算法,以防止暴力破解。
3. **公钥和地址生成**:基于生成的私钥,可以使用特定的算法(例如椭圆曲线数字签名算法,ECDSA)来计算出公钥,再通过哈希算法生成比特币地址。一般来说,用户只需简单的点击操作,钱包软件会自动完成这一系列的复杂计算。
比特币地址泄露是怎样的影响?
比特币的钱包地址如果泄露,将可能带来严重的后果。以下是一些潜在影响:
1. **资金损失**:一旦地址泄露,任何人都可以通过已知方式向该地址转账,并有可能获得对该地址内资金的控制。虽然比特币地址本身不包含身份信息,但若结合其它数据,黑客或不法分子可能推断出用户身份并恶意转走资金。
2. **隐私侵害**:泄露地址会导致用户交易活动暴露。所有比特币交易记录都被记录在区块链上,任何具有该地址的人都可以查看其交易历史,进而获取用户的其他信息。
3. **网络威胁**:在一些严重情况下,地址泄露可能导致其他网络攻击,如钓鱼诈骗或勒索病毒等攻击,用户需对此保持警惕,以保障个人信息及资金安全。
比特币钱包地址如何保护?
保护比特币钱包地址和私钥非常关键,以下几点常见保护措施可供参考:
1. **使用硬件钱包**:考虑使用硬件钱包(如Ledger或Trezor等),这类设备在保持私钥离线存储的情况下,能够有效降低网络攻击风险。
2. **启用双重认证**:许多比特币钱包提供双重认证的功能,用户应积极启用此功能,以增加资金安全保护的层级,降低被盗的风险。
3. **避免不安全的网络环境**:尽量避免在公共Wi-Fi等不安全的网络环境中进行交易,确保在安全的网络下使用比特币。此外,使用VPN等工具可以增加信息的保密性。
常见问题解答
比特币钱包可以有多少个地址?
每个比特币钱包可以生成多个地址,实际上,该数量是没有限制的。用户根据具体需求,可以创建不同的地址,以分散或管理资金。例如,出于隐私和安全的目的,很多用户选择使用多个地址来接收不同的交易。然而,需注意的是,每个地址虽然都是独立的,但都与同一个私钥相连,管理这些地址时需谨慎,以免造成资金丢失。
我可以使用相同的比特币地址吗?
虽然技术上一个比特币地址可以重复使用,但并不被推荐。如果长期使用同一个地址,可能导致隐私泄露和安全风险增加。例如,确保每次交易使用新的地址可以更好地保护用户身份和交易活动。有些钱包会自动生成新地址,以更有效的管理比特币交易和资金流动。
比特币地址是否需要保留私钥?
是的,用户在创建比特币地址时必须始终保留其私钥。私钥是访问和控制该地址中比特币的唯一凭证。若丢失私钥,便无法找回地址中任何资金。存储私钥时应使用安全的方式,如冷存储(离线)或硬件钱包等方式,避免恶意攻击者窃取。
比特币地址在哪里查看?
用户可以通过比特币钱包软件查看自己的钱包地址。大多数钱包应用在接口中都有清晰的展示,通常一目了然。其中也包括可用的二维码和复制链接的功能,用户可以方便地分享给对方进行交易。除此之外,区块链浏览器也是查看特定地址交易记录和余额的可靠工具。
综上所述,比特币钱包地址的位数直接影响交易的安全性和用户的隐私。借助现代的技术手段,用户能够更加安全、便捷地管理和使用比特币。在使用比特币的过程中,需要时刻保持警惕,积极采取保护措施,以确保资产的安全和隐私。希望本文的分析和解答能够对用户理解和使用比特币钱包地址有所帮助。